Ratings from the KALXCWG specification sheet, measured at AHRI 550/590 test conditions. kW/ton = 3.517 ÷ COP (full load) or 3.517 ÷ IPLV (part load); lower is better. FEMP thresholds are the U.S. Department of Energy Federal Energy Management Program minimum efficiencies for part-load-optimized water-cooled centrifugal chillers. This tool is a first-pass selection aid, not a substitute for a plant load calculation at your condenser water temperature.
